Current research from the field of psychology suggests that the maintenance of change and the integration of insight into everyday living is perhaps the most unresolved challenge in the healing professions. We are a culture enamored by the beauty of wisdom - the poetry of eastern thought, or the manicured how-to's of mindful living; we spend millions of dollars each year on inspirational workshops, rejuvenating wellness retreats, and self-help solutions. But change requires more than a climactic ending to a well-told story. A world of integration and maintenance must be reconciled if any lasting meaning, any true change, is to come. As a response, FROM THIS DAY ON explores two essential areas: what exactly impedes the maintenance of insight, and how can we effectively overcome these challenges? Dr Lori Jespersen s new book sees to it that the inspiration and meaning found on the path to change does not fade upon the return home.

Dr Lori Jespersen’s new book sees to it that the inspiration and meaning found on the path to change does not fade upon the return home.When all is said and done, the unmistakable truth is that we can listen to the finest deliverers of enlightenment that every continent has to offer, just as we could eat the finest meal that the most acclaimed chef could create. But I say to you, this does not translate into the ability to go home and recreate the meal. So in this book, I offer you my recipe—a slow and methodical application of how to cook the spiritual good stuff when you get home. Because, when you leave the church, the retreat, the wellness center, even the spiritual café, the chef isn’t coming with you. Eventually you will be alone in the kitchen, spoon in hand, wondering what that delicious taste was again—and how, exactly, did they cook it?
About the Author:
DR. LORI JESPERSEN, PSY.D, a clinical
psychologist, has explored the avenues by which people maintain change across a broad scope of
experience and psychological philosophies. In FROM THIS DAY ON, Jespersen s first book, she explores what recent and relevant research from the clinical world has learned about our ability to change our internal maintenance process and set
the stage so the practical implementation of insight into our daily lives, habits, and routines
can become a reality.
